Along almost every tropical coastline you can find the tangled
roots of mangrove trees, a natural barrier against extreme
weather. They are also one of the most powerful weapons we have
for fighting climate change. Mangrove forests are six times
better at capturing carbon than tropical forests. But in the last
40 years up to a third of mangrove forests worldwide have
disappeared.
